关于网页前端开发的问题
首先要明确,html是前端的基础!Web前端开发是从网页制作演变而来的,名称上有很明显的时代特征。在互联网的演化进程中,网页制作是Web1.0时代产物,那时网站的主要内容是静态的,用户使用网站的行为也以浏览为主。2005年以后,互联网进入Web2.0时代,各种类似桌面软件的Web应用大量涌现,网站的前端由此发生了翻天覆地的变化。网页不再只是承载单一的文字和图片,各种富媒体让网页的内容更加生动,网页上软件化的交互形式为用户提供了更好的使用体验,这些都是基于前端技术实现的。
Web前端的学习建议
现在很多人都喜欢自学web前端开发,但是自学是很难在web前端开发这条路上走远的,而且现在网上很多的视频和资料都是过期的。给大家推荐一个裙,前面是四94,中间的是O6四,后面还剩下的是9叁4,只要你是想学习的就可以加入,如果不是想学习的就不要加入了。
Web前端的学习误区
入门快、见效快让我们在不知不觉中已经深深爱上了网页制作。此时,很多人会陷入一个误区,那就是既然借助这么帅的IDE,通过鼠标点击菜单就可以快速方便地制作网页。
那么我们为什么还要去学习HTML、CSS、JavaScrpt、jQuery等这些苦逼的代码呢?这不是舍简求繁吗?
但是随着学习的深入,就会发现我们步入了一种窘境——过分的依赖IDE导致我们不清楚其实现的本质,知其然但不知其所以然。
因此在页面效果出现问题时,我们便手足无措,更不用提如何进行页面优化以及完成一些更高级的应用了。其原因是显而易见的——聪明的IDE成全了我们的惰性,使我们忽略了华丽的网页背后最本质的内容——code。
在学习Web前端中的一些建议和方法。
在CSS布局时需要注意的一个问题是很多同学缺乏对页面布局进行整体分析,不能够从宏观上对页面中盒子间的嵌套关系进行把握,就急于动手去做,导致页面中各元素间的关系很混乱,容易出现盒子在浮动时错位等情况。建议大家在布局时采用“自顶向下,逐步细化”的思想,先用几个盒子将页面从整体上划分,然后逐步在盒子中继续嵌套盒子。
“君子生非异也,善假于物也”,在学习的过程中还要多浏览一些优秀的网站,善于分析借鉴其设计思路和布局方法,见多方能识广,进而才可以融会贯通,取他人之长为我所用。
web前端开发工程师做为互联网行业紧缺的职位之一,人才缺口巨大,每天还在不断的更新。人才少,薪资自然也是很吸引人的,据某网站77939样本统计从业人员平均月薪9690元,而且跟据经验的增加,薪资也是在不断的攀高的。
引用乔布斯的话,Web就是未来,我们作为前端开发工作者也是未来。相信Web前端开发的明天会更好。
你上面说到的JS框架,说到底现在一般也就是JQUEYR这样的东西,这个东西本身其实是为了优化JS使用而存在的,只不过是个写好的JS文件而已,上来就学这个可能会感觉死记硬背的好烦,我建议你学习一些JS的基本知识,然后在看JQUERY这些包。
开始的工作不可能很复杂所以应该把工作学习重点放在DIV+CSS的布局上,这其中其实也有很多要学的地方,特别是浏览器兼容上的事,是需要慢慢的积累和习惯的。一开始JS实在不会可以网上搜人家写好的,反正常用的也就几个JS,最好不要搜用了JQEURY的,不能提高新手水平的。
所谓的审美,我可以很现实的告诉你,小公司为了省钱肯定请不起专业做美工的,所以都只可能是半吊子的美工,而大公司是有专门做美工的人员的,人家都是灰常NB的,不需要你查收。你的话会用PS,会用网上搜索到的素材,经常性的看看TAOBAO啊,微博啊之类的布局,美工足够了,真要做到精通美工,先问下公司肯不肯给你10K一个月。